I'm Fine...And Other LiesYou expect a book by Whitney Cummings, stand-up comic, actor and creator/co-creator of two network sitcoms, including the long-running “Two Broke Girls” would be funny. What you wouldn’t expect is that her memoir “I’m Fine … And Other Lies” would be such a frank, deeply moving account of her experiences with codependence, eating disorders, abortion, consent, fertility as well as many others.

“I feel I had dealt with a lot of my codependence in my personal life and professional life but it still was rearing its ugly head in other ways,” she told me. “Codependence is like a game of whack-a-mole. You think you’ve dealt with one part, another part pops up.”

“I so badly wanted everything to be easy that I ignored reality,” she continued. “The same mentality can be, ‘Oh, this guy will change. He’s done this with every other woman but if I just love him enough, he’ll change.’ Or, ‘My boss yells at me every day but if I just dress a certain way or get this brief in on time, she’ll stop.’ These things that we tell ourselves to self-soothe but ultimately end up putting us in dangerous situations, for me is a slippery slope.”

The theme of her book mimics her comedic style. There will be honesty and humor enough for any “2 Broke Girl” fan.
